Knightriders is the story of a troupe of motorcyclists who are members of a travelling renaissance faire. They move from town to town, staging jousting tournaments with combatants in suits of armour, wielding lances, battle-axes, maces and broadswords. The spectacle of this magnificent pageant soon garners national attention and the knights soon find difficulty in maintaining their fairy-tale existence in a world fraught with corruption. The film is a change of pace for Romero, known primarily for horror films. Look for the cameo by Stephen King as the "Loudmouth Spectator."
